Issue:
I am seeing the same thing as user LKH, that is GIMP does not render 30-bit, deep color on my Linux system. (I do not have Adobe Photoshop on Windows, so this I have not tested).

I understand many conditions have to be fulfilled:
1) Application can render: I am using GIMP_2_99_8-110-g44f6ee36fe compiled from git source.

2) OS can render: I am using Debian 11 with X11 with 30 bit depth enabled (not Wayland):
xwininfo -root | grep Depth =>   Depth: 30
glxinfo | grep "direct rendering" => direct rendering: Yes

3) I have an NVIDIA Quadro RTX 4000 GPU with NVIDIA drivers that support 30 bits and Nvidia Xserver Setting app report back 30 bits when checked

4) I am using EIZO GLX 2790X wide gamut monitor and monitor reports that it is operating in 10 bits when queried: EIZO monitor | Signal => Full Range, RGB 10 bit

5) A set of test files which actually has 10 bit or more raster and GIMP in 16 bit mode: GIMP | Image | Encoding => 16 bit

I can still see no difference between an 8 bit gradient (in 8 bits) and a 16-bit gradient (in 16 bits).

I use these test images (I have used other test files as well. Same result. No 10 bit gradation is rendered in GIMP display):
